Understanding Harshness and Sibilance

Before diving into solutions, it’s essential to understand what harshness and sibilance are:

  • Harshness: This refers to an unpleasant, grating quality in the vocal sound, often caused by excessive mid-range frequencies.
  • Sibilance: This is the overemphasis of sibilant sounds, particularly ‘s’, ‘sh’, and ‘t’ sounds, that can lead to a piercing quality in recordings.

Common Causes of Harshness and Sibilance

Identifying the root causes of these issues can help in applying the right fixes. Common causes include:

  • Poor microphone choice or placement
  • Room acoustics and reflections
  • Improper gain staging during recording
  • Inherent qualities of the vocalist’s voice

Techniques to Fix Harshness

There are several techniques you can employ to reduce harshness in vocal tracks:

  • EQ Adjustments: Use an equalizer to gently reduce frequencies between 2 kHz and 5 kHz, where harshness often resides.
  • Dynamic EQ: Utilize a dynamic EQ to target harsh frequencies only when they exceed a certain threshold.
  • De-essing: While primarily used for sibilance, a de-esser can also help tame harshness by targeting problematic frequencies.
  • Mid/Side Processing: Apply EQ in mid/side mode to reduce harshness in the center while maintaining clarity in the sides.

Techniques to Fix Sibilance

Sibilance can be particularly challenging, but there are effective methods to manage it:

  • De-esser: Use a de-esser plugin to specifically target and reduce sibilant frequencies without affecting the rest of the vocal.
  • Manual Editing: Consider manually lowering the volume of sibilant sections in the audio waveform.
  • EQ Notching: Apply a narrow EQ notch around 5 kHz to 8 kHz to reduce sibilance without dulling the overall vocal.
  • Microphone Technique: Encourage vocalists to adjust their distance from the microphone while singing sibilant sounds.

Recording Tips to Prevent Harshness and Sibilance

Prevention is always better than cure. Here are some recording tips to help avoid these issues from the outset:

  • Choose the Right Microphone: Select a microphone that complements the vocalist’s voice and minimizes harshness.
  • Optimize Microphone Placement: Experiment with distance and angle to find the sweet spot that captures the best sound.
  • Acoustic Treatment: Improve room acoustics with sound-absorbing materials to reduce reflections and resonance.
  • Use Pop Filters: Employ pop filters to reduce plosive sounds that can exacerbate sibilance.
